It is very important that university information and educational materials that are delivered via the web are accessible to people with disabilities. The World Wide Web Consortium’s Web Accessibility Initiative has established guidelines to help content designers make sure information published on websites can be accessed by individuals who are using emerging or assistive technologies. Disability Support Services can offer information, training, and support for content designers who need to bring existing sites into compliance, or who are designing new sites and want to ensure accessibility from the beginning.
